The Caucasian Shepherd Dog and Tibetan Mastiff are both awe-inspiring canines whose very presence commands respect. They descend from ancient dogs in the Caucasus mountains and Tibet and protecting people and property is a job that these kinds of dogs have performed diligently and fearlessly for eons. Though breed alone doesn’t determine a dog’s personality, different breeds are commonly linked to certain character traits. Being rather vocal is a trait that’s commonly linked with Shelties (Shetland Sheepdogs), and their barks are famously loud and shrill.
